I Have Not Relocated To Nigeria Because Of Los Angeles Wildfire: Omotola Jalade Ekehinde Addresses Misconception
Popular veteran Nollywood actress, Omotola Jalade Ekehinde, has cleared the air on the misconception that she has relocated to Nigeria, over the recent wildfire in Los Angeles.
The versatile actress recently announced her arrival in Nigeria on her Instagram page: “Touchdown Abuja. When my American fans follow me back to Nigeria. I had to evacuate in 20 minutes. Please, guys, stay safe out there. If you have family in LA, check on them.”
However, since the actress' post, rumours have been flying around that the actress evacuated and relocated from the United States to Nigeria, based on the wildfire in Los Angeles.
Addressing the misconception via her Instagram page, Omotola Jalade Ekeinde wrote:
"I want to take a moment to address the incredible outpouring of concern and support I have received regarding the fires in Los Angeles.
"To set the record straight: My family and I are safe. However, I have seen reports suggesting that I had to leave the U.S. because of the fire. This is inaccurate.
“I have been in Nigeria since December 2024, and I’m still here presently. While I deeply cherish my connection to LA, these fires were not the reason for my travel.”
